Analysis and control of ultrafast photoinduced reactions
"The present monograph summarizes, in a comprehensive way, several years of joint experimental and theoretical frontier research on ultrafast laser-induced molecular dynamics and its control. Emphasis is placed on the characterization of the nuclear dynamics within molecular systems in various...
